- This is the story of Moirai, A game no one can play anymore. It was created by Australian Indie Game developer Chris Johnson. Popularised on RUclips by channels such as Markiplier and Jacksepticeye in late 2016 the game took off on Steam. All was going well until someone took poorly to the game success.

I know the person who got the game taken down, and there's a lot of misinformation/superstition surrounding the method used to fill the database. There weren't "servers" used to host entries; it was a single SQL database that anyone could've accessed because plaintext credentials were bundled with the game during distribution. The database getting filled with garbage data was inevitable.

@@JinxBigStompa From what I've seen, the conversation Chris had published by CNET/PC Gamer was fabricated to fit his victim narrative and promote his other games. He also lied multiple times about the method used to fill the database with junk data so he could dramatize the events and act as if it was a sophisticated, coordinated attack. It wasn't. He distributed his credentials to literally everyone who downloaded it.
The only hint of truth to their conversation were the first couple quotes published. Actual conversation:
- Chris gets an invite from my friend after being spotted on the Steam forums.
- Chris opens with:
"Why'd you do it?"
Friend: "I thought it was funny"
C: "For the lolz, eh?"
F: "you bet my man"
C: "What did you think about the game?"
- Friend asks another friend of ours to write up his actual thoughts on the game. That's relayed to Chris.
F: "I thought it was interesting, and that the camera and fog made it feel eerie. The positioning of the camera, the slow speed of the player, makes you feel vulnerable."
- Friend then asks Chris to play a Roblox game he and the other friend had given up on years prior.
- Conversation ends.
I think if you find an obvious security vulnerability, you should prod at it until it gets noticed. The database was filled with a single line of text, by a single person, and Chris could've addressed the issue by temporarily taking the SQL database offline to change his credentials. It wasn't a continual problem either. There was never a script published to the game's discussions page. The database was filled *once* and that was enough for Chris to take the game offline permanently.
